Abstract

Grass cutting is essential for maintaining the appearance and safety of lawns, gardens, and parks. However, traditional gasoline or electric grass cutters, including their air and noise pollution, hurt the environment. This research work has designed and constructed a solar-powered grass cutter that operates using renewable solar energy. The grass cutter consists of a motor, blade, frame, wheels, and solar panels that convert sunlight into electricity. This study has conducted testing to evaluate the performance of the solar grass cutter, including its cutting ability and energy efficiency. The results showed that the solar grass cutter was effective in cutting grass and had a comparable cutting ability to traditional grass cutters. Additionally, this use of solar energy reduces the environmental impact of grass- cutting by eliminating greenhouse gas emissions and reducing noise pollution. This project demonstrates the feasibility and benefits of using solar power for grass and provides a potential solution for more sustainable and eco-friendly lawn maintenance practices.
